The hexadecimal value (hex value) of this color is #dccfdf. In RGB, it consists of 86.3% Red, 81.2% Green, and 87.5% Blue. Likewise, in the CMYK color space, it consists of 1.3% Cyan, 7.2% Magenta, 0% Yellow, and 12.5% Black. On the color wheel, its Hue is found at 288.8°, with saturation of 20% and lightness of 84.3%. The decimal value for #dccfdf is 14471135, and its nearest "web safe" color is #cccccc. In the RGB color space, the strongest component for #dccfdf is blue. In the CMYK color space, its strongest component is black. And in the RYB color space, its strongest component is blue.

Analogous Colors of #dccfdf

Analogous colors are located 30 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el. For #dccfdf — which has hue 288.8° — its analogous colors are located at 258.8° and 318.8°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#dccfdf.

Triadic Colors of #dccfdf

Triadic colors are located 120 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el, which means the original color and its triadic colors are equidistant from one another on the color wheel and form a triangle. For #dccfdf — which has hue 288.8° — its triadic colors are located at 48.8° and 288.8°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#dccfdf.

Complementary Color of #dccfdf

A complementary color is located opposite a color on the color wheel (180 degrees away). For #dccfdf — which has hue 288.8° — its complementary color is located at 108.8°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#dccfdf.

Accessibility

Not Accessibility Recommended

We analyzed whether #dccfdf is an accessible color when used as a text / foreground color against a white background. This analysis is based on the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2 Level issued by W3C. Based on this analysis, we calculate a contrast ratio against white of approximately 1.5:1 against white. Under both the AA and AAA level standards, this is not a high enough ratio to be considered accessible for either normal size or large text.
